Mireille Mathieu, at Mrs Marie-Josée Roig's invitation, Mayor of Avignon and President de Avignon-Tourisme, generously agreed to be the godmother of this space.
(Inauguration in June 1st, 2006)

   

A space dedicated to the song which makes of Avignon, after Paris, the most famous city of France worldwide...

Besides the classic treatment of places (signalling system of information with cultural character) where are evoked the history(story) and the legend of the construction of the bridge(deck), the implemented techniques, the river transit and the role of the building in the economic boom of the city, a space is more particularly dedicated to the song.


This room is in the châtelet which protects the access to the city at the end of the bridge.
It is handled in a spirit different from all the spaces (treatment in tones blue harms and glace chestnut, sieved lighting) so as to create a felted atmosphere, close to a recording studio.

A cyma equipped with niches backlight evokes the history of the song, with varied illustrations, scores, ancient postcards, idealized images.

A wall of images animates the room of children's silhouettes which dance, thrown in shadow plays.
Diverse versions of the song, in several languages and in various musical styles, are diffused in buckle in elements of furniture feigning departures of arcs of the building. To listen to them, it is necessary to stick its ear against drillings equipped with small loudspeakers, as child the fact with a shell.
The clientele of the Bridge of Avignon being essentially family, this space addresses quite particularly a public young person, of children and teenagers.
